An example of a pH response cycle in E. coli, dissected by Olson and by Bennett, is that of lysine decarboxylase, the cadBA operon ( Figure 4 ). Lysine decarboxylase (CadA) removes carbon dioxide from lysine, thus producing cadaverine, an amine which protonates to generate OH −. lysine decarboxylase test decarboxylation test quizletAbstract. Four lysine decarboxylase media were studied by testing them with 305 Enterobacteriaceae and 42 nonfermenting bacilli. A comparison was made between lysine decarboxylase broth medium (Moeller base) and Johnson's semisolid agar without lactose and Bachrach's broth medium and lysine-agar slants which contain lactose.
